I'm writing this because I can find plenty of people saying that "you
need to use mixed authentication" when you get this error, but not much
else. I am able to open Query analyzer and log in using the computer
name, let's say in this case it is WORKGROUP\SQLSRVR and log in with my
SQL username and password, no problem. As soon as I change that
computer name to the computer's IP address I get the "Not Associated
with a Trusted Connection" error. THEN, if i try to log in again
through query analyzer with the IP and check Windows Authentication it
works just fine. I really do not want this though. I want to log in
with the IP address and SQL username and password.
